Sapphire Pulse Radeon RX 570 8GD5: boasts a maximum frequency of 1.168 GHz GHz + 6%. It is equipped with 8 GBGB of RAM. The memory type is GDDR5. It was released in Q3/2017.

Palit GeForce GTX 1070 Dual: It has a maximum clock speed of 1.506 GHz GHz. It comes with 8 GBGB of memory. The memory type is GDDR5. Released in Q1 Q3/2016.

General Information

This section provides a detailed comparison of the fundamental technical specifications of the graphics cards Sapphire Pulse Radeon RX 570 8GD5 and Palit GeForce GTX 1070 Dual. It includes key information such as the GPU chip architecture, the number of processing units, and other core features that directly impact the overall performance of the cards in various applications, including gaming and professional workloads.

  • Based on
    AMD Radeon RX 570 left arrow NVIDIA GeForce GTX 1070
  • GPU Chip
    Polaris 20 XL left arrow GP104-200-A1
  • Execution units
    32 left arrow 15
  • Shader
    2048 left arrow 1920
  • Render Output Units
    32 left arrow 64
  • Texture Units
    128 left arrow 120
Memory Configuration

This section provides a comparison of the memory configurations of Sapphire Pulse Radeon RX 570 8GD5 and Palit GeForce GTX 1070 Dual. It includes details such as the memory size, type (e.g., GDDR6, HBM2), and bandwidth, which are key factors that determine how efficiently the card handles large textures, data sets, and high-resolution tasks.Larger memory sizes are typically beneficial for demanding applications like 4K gaming and video editing.

  • Memory Size
    8 GB left arrow 8 GB
  • Memory Type
    GDDR5 left arrow GDDR5
  • Memory Speed
    1.75 GHz left arrow 2.002 GHz
  • Memory Bandwith
    224 GB/s left arrow 256 GB/s
  • Memory Interface
    256 bit left arrow 256 bit
